Fostering a dog is one of many ways you can help improve the lives of homeless pets. Foster care for dogs basically requires patience, a compassionate nature, a flexible lifestyle, and some experience with and knowledge of dog behavior. On average each foster period lasts about 10-14 days, give or take a few days. Sometimes if it a slow season (travel season) it can take a bit longer, or if you have a dog with behavioral/medical issues. Type of pet: Cats, dogs (small, medium and large) and rabbits. Find out more. Urban Cat Alliance.Aug 11, 2022 · How to Introduce a New Dog to Your Family. Always ask about social tendencies before bringing a foster dog home. Allow the dog to get comfy in the new surroundings before introducing your cat. When you do, keep the foster on a leash and let him sniff his new pal. In the best case scenario, your cat will be indifferent. Foster homes are most needed for: Dogs over 40 lbs who are stressed in the shelter environment; Animals who are sick; Animals who need behavior training or socializationMyth #5 – Fostering is Bad for Your Pets. Having strange dogs come and go will be confusing to resident pets at first. Luckily, in most cases, your pets will benefit from fostering more than anything else. Foster dogs and resident pets can get extra socialization from the situation.
